enableEventPropagation

enableEventPropagation(enable): AnchoredShape

Enable event propagation from the node hierarchy from bottom to top

This option is similar to DOM Event bubbling, which allows to get any event from child node. By default it is disabled for better performance.

Example

import {Group} from '@int/geotoolkit/scene/Group';
import {Events as SceneEvents} from '@int/geotoolkit/scene/Node';
const parentGroup = new Group()
.setName('ParentGroup')
.enableEventPropagation(true);
const childGroup = new Group()
.setName('ChildGroup');

parentGroup.addChild(childGroup);
parentGroup.on(SceneEvents.Invalidate, (eventName, sender, args) => {
// Got notifications from all children of parent group
});
childGroup.invalidate();

Parameters

Name Type Description
enablebooleanenable

Returns

AnchoredShape

this

Inherited from

Shape.enableEventPropagation


execute

execute(delegate): AnchoredShape

Executes delegate and return the result. It allows us to keep all initialization calls in one place,
and we do not need to scroll up or down in IDE to find how and where it was initialized.

Example

// All setters (.setName() for example) returns reference to the this.
// In order to modify inner object like LineStyle or Pattern, to get this object (property) we should call getter to get object reference.
// Then modify it as shown below in Option 1 or you can use execute methods shown in Option 2.
import {Group} from '@int/geotoolkit/scene/Group';
import {Rect} from '@int/geotoolkit/util/Rect';
// Option 1
const group = new Group()
.setName('MyGroup')
.setBounds(new Rect(0, 0, 42, 16))
.enableClipping(true)
.setTag({'type': 'sometype'});

group.getLineStyle().setPattern('pattern');
return group;

// Options 2 ( using execute method )
return group
.execute(function () {
this.getLineStyle()
.setPattern("pattern");
});

Parameters

Name Type Description
delegate(this: AnchoredShape) => voidFunction to execute

Returns

AnchoredShape

The result if any or this

Inherited from

Shape.execute

on

on<E>(type, callback): AnchoredShape

Attach listener on event that will be called whenever the specified event is delivered to the target

If the callback function is already in the list of event listeners for this target, the function is not added a second time.

If a particular anonymous function is in the list of event listeners registered for a certain target, and then later in the code, an identical anonymous function is given in an "on" call, the second function will also be added to the list of event listeners for that target.

Type parameters

NameType
Eextends string

Parameters

Name Type Description
typeEtype of event or property
callback(eventType: E, sender: AnchoredShape, args: EventMap[E]) => voidto be called

Returns

AnchoredShape

this

Inherited from

Shape.on
